Review

The 2006 Honda VFR, often known as the VFR800, continued the celebrated lineage of Honda's sport touring machines, a line recognized for its sophisticated engineering and versatility. Positioned squarely in the sport touring category, the 2006 VFR faced stiff competition from rivals such as the Yamaha FJR1300 and the Kawasaki Concours 14, offering a more compact and agile alternative within the segment. This particular model year maintained the VFR's reputation for a balanced approach to spirited riding and long-distance comfort, appealing to riders who desired more than a dedicated sportbike without sacrificing engaging performance.

At its heart, the 2006 VFR boasted a 782.00 ccm (47.72 cubic inches) V4 engine, a powerplant known for its distinctive sound and smooth power delivery. This engine produced a robust 107.28 HP (78.3 kW) at 10500 RPM, providing ample power for both spirited canyon carving and effortless highway cruising. Torque figures stood at 80.00 Nm (8.2 kgf-m or 59.0 ft.lbs) at 8750 RPM, ensuring strong acceleration through the mid-range. With a dry weight of 213.0 kg (469.6 pounds) and a substantial fuel capacity of 22.00 litres (5.81 gallons), the VFR was built for extended journeys, offering a considerable range between fill-ups.

Riding the 2006 VFR offered a refined experience characteristic of sport touring motorcycles. The seat height, at 805 mm (31.7 inches) in its lowest adjustable setting, accommodated a wide range of riders, providing a comfortable perch for long hours in the saddle. While not featuring the track-focused ergonomics of a pure sportbike, the VFR's riding position struck a comfortable balance, leaning slightly forward without being overly aggressive. Its fairing provided effective wind protection, crucial for reducing rider fatigue on extended tours. The chassis geometry contributed to stable handling, instilling confidence whether navigating sweeping bends or maintaining a steady pace on the motorway.

The 2006 Honda VFR was aimed at experienced riders who appreciate a motorcycle capable of covering significant distances in comfort while still offering a genuinely engaging riding experience. It appealed to those who value Honda's renowned build quality and reliability, seeking a versatile machine that could handle weekend blasts as effectively as cross-country tours. Its V4 engine, combined with its practical touring capabilities, made it a compelling choice for riders desiring a sophisticated and capable sport touring motorcycle that prioritized both performance and practicality.
